The builders of the popular open-source database server MySQL have announced version 4.0.12 of their program. With this release, the 4.0.x branch of the software has finally received its long-awaited stable. This makes 4.0.12 the recommended version from now on when MySQL is used in a production environment. To make this happen, a lot of bugs have been squashed but also a few features have been added:

Functionality added or changed:

  • `mysqld’ no longer reads options from world-writeable config files.
  • Integer values ​​between 9223372036854775807 and 9999999999999999999 are now regarded as unsigned longlongs, not as floats. This makes these values ​​work similar to values ​​between 10000000000000000000 and 18446744073709551615.
  • SHOW PROCESSLIST will now include the client TCP port after the hostname to make it easier to know from which client the request originated.
